Types of Ignition Wrench Set
When it comes to ignition systems, having the right tools at your disposal is crucial for effective maintenance and repairs. An ignition wrench set is available in various types, tailored to meet varying automotive needs. Understanding these types can help you choose the right set for your specific requirements:
- Standard Ignition Wrench Set: These typically include a range of sizes to fit most common ignition components, making them versatile for everyday use.
- Deep Socket Ignition Wrench Set: This type is designed for hard-to-reach areas, providing additional depth to accommodate longer bolts found in ignition systems.
- Flexhead Ignition Wrenches: The flexible head allows for better maneuverability in tight spaces, perfect for working around engine components.
- Magnetic Ignition Wrench Set: Equipped with magnetic tips, these wrenches hold bolts securely, preventing them from slipping and falling into intricate engine regions.
Function and Feature of Ignition Wrench Set
An ignition wrench set is designed with specific functions and features that enhance its usability and efficiency in automotive applications:
- Precision Engineering: Each wrench is meticulously crafted for precise fit and ease of use, minimizing the risk of rounding off fasteners.
- Ergonomic Design: Most sets come with ergonomically designed handles for comfortable grip and reduced fatigue during extended use.
- Corrosion-Resistant Coating: Many ignition wrenches feature a protective coating that resists rust and corrosion, ensuring longevity even when exposed to harsh environments.
- Easily Identifiable Sizes: The sizes are often clearly marked, allowing for quick identification, which speeds up the work process.
